> Whereabouts is the HTML content now?  One option might be to convert,
> host as a website and have a help context displayer that opens the
> system browser with pages based on the HelpCtx ID, falling back to
> root table of contents if not there?  I'm doing the latter bit in the
> PraxisLIVE UI, where every help button at least does something.
> Started experimenting with encoding the context in the URL's but
> didn't finish it.
